Voters will go to the polls Saturday to decide on 13 proposed constitutional amendments. The Council for A Better Louisiana has taken a position on all 13. The Greater Lafayette Chamber of Commerce has endorsed amendment No. 3 and the Governmental Affairs Committee is reviewing No. 10.
Statewide elections for a secretary of state, an insurance commissioner and 13 constitutional amendments will be on the Sept. 30 election ballot. Early voting is 8:30 a.m.-4:30 p.m. through Saturday, Sept. 23, in voter registrar offices.
